Chettinad Beetroot Kola Urundai – Chettinad Recipes
Kola urundai recipes are very famous in Chettinad region in Tamil Nadu. It can be either vegetarian or non-vegetarian and has got many variations. Avarakkai Poriyal Recipe – Broad Beans Stir fry – அவரைக்காய் பொரியல்
Avarakkai – அவரைக்காய் / Indian Broad Beans is mostly a country / village style vegetable. We at home call it naatu avarakkai and use it to make poriyal, curry & sambar. Baby Potato Fry – Urulaikizhangu Roast
Baby Potato Fry is a quick and flavorful potato roast or stir-fry prepared with special South Indian spice blend.
